想了解javawebservice學(xué)習(xí)嗎?想了解java學(xué)習(xí)筆記之WebService?? 嗎?......本文帶你一探究竟。
1.java學(xué)習(xí)筆記之WebService
1 是用來做什么?是一種跨編程語言和跨操作系統(tǒng)知識(shí)庫"操作系統(tǒng)平臺(tái)的遠(yuǎn)程調(diào)用技術(shù)。用于網(wǎng)絡(luò)通信,多臺(tái)機(jī)器之間的數(shù)據(jù)交互。2 與socket的區(qū)別1. socket是在網(wǎng)絡(luò)中的數(shù)據(jù)傳輸層,采用的是TCP/UDP協(xié)議,是屬于應(yīng)用層,采用的是http協(xié)議2. socket建立是長(zhǎng)連接,建立的是短連接(調(diào)用服務(wù)時(shí)建立連接,調(diào)用完畢后斷開連接)相關(guān)的術(shù)語1)XML:擴(kuò)展型標(biāo)記語言2)SOAP:簡(jiǎn)單對(duì)象訪問協(xié)議,是一個(gè)xml調(diào)用規(guī)范,它支持http,https,smtp通信協(xié)議。3)WSDL:web描述性語言。wsdl文件是一個(gè)xml文檔。用于說明一組SOAP消息以及如何交換這些消息。4)UDDI:通用描述、發(fā)現(xiàn)與集成服務(wù)。比喻:就像一個(gè)服務(wù)提供商,SOAP就像雙方簽的合同,約束雙方按規(guī)律和標(biāo)準(zhǔn)來辦事。WSDL就像一個(gè)說明書,你能給別人提供說明服務(wù)。UUDI就像是公司在工商局注冊(cè),說明公司經(jīng)營(yíng)什么內(nèi)容,方便別人查詢。PS:純屬個(gè)人隨筆的筆記,也是在網(wǎng)上轉(zhuǎn)載的學(xué)習(xí)資料!
上述文章了解到關(guān)于java學(xué)習(xí)筆記之WebService?? ,讓我們對(duì)javawebservice學(xué)習(xí) 有一個(gè)直觀的認(rèn)知。我們發(fā)現(xiàn),作為一個(gè)優(yōu)秀的Java程序員是多么的自豪。